Transaction ef40be74359e4684044556c071a3494c8b72ef9147bb0c16ae2970ae254c6548
1 Input
1 Output
-
ef40be74359e4684044556c071a3494c8b72ef9147bb0c16ae2970ae254c6548:0
- value
- 14025133
- script pubkey
- OP_0 OP_PUSHBYTES_20 abd966852561e91c4c6c84ae33585fea52c6592c
- address
- bc1q40vkdpf9v853cnrvsjhrxkzlaffvvkfvjthd8e